From 2f28b3f7bef16fe63541bf5ba40f8e8f10ec5667 Mon Sep 17 00:00:00 2001 From: ECQZXC Date: Tue, 11 Mar 2025 17:02:28 +0800 Subject: [PATCH] =?UTF-8?q?fix:=20=E4=BF=AE=E5=A4=8D=E4=BA=BA=E8=84=B8?= =?UTF-8?q?=E5=BD=95=E5=85=A5=E8=BF=87=E7=A8=8B=E4=B8=AD,=E5=85=B3?= =?UTF-8?q?=E9=97=AD=E7=AA=97=E5=8F=A3=E5=90=8E,=E4=BA=BA=E8=84=B8?= =?UTF-8?q?=E8=AE=BE=E5=A4=87=E6=9C=AA=E5=8D=B3=E6=97=B6=E9=80=80=E5=87=BA?= =?UTF-8?q?=E9=97=AE=E9=A2=98?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it 未及时释放设备对象 pms: BUG-307657 --- workmodule.cpp | 2 ++ 1 file changed, 2 insertions(+) diff --git a/workmodule.cpp b/workmodule.cpp index 30f1f0a..6bad37e 100644 --- a/workmodule.cpp +++ b/workmodule.cpp @@ -72,6 +72,7 @@ void ErollThread::Stop() m_stopCapture = true; m_camera->stop(); m_camera->unload(); + m_camera.reset(); close(m_fileSocket); } @@ -476,5 +477,6 @@ void VerifyThread::Stop() free(m_charaDatas[i]); } } + m_camera.reset(); m_charaDatas.clear(); }